What exactly is fill dirt and when should I use it in Willard, NC?

Fill dirt is subsoil with minimal organic material used to raise or level ground and fill low spots. In Willard it’s commonly used for grading yards, raising building pads above wet spots, and filling utility trenches before topsoil and landscaping are added. It isn’t suitable as a final planting surface because it lacks nutrients and may be compacted before adding topsoil.

How do I calculate how much fill dirt I need for a yard or grading project?

Measure the area in square feet and the average depth in inches, then use this formula: cubic yards = (area ft2 × depth in) ÷ 324. To convert to tons for ordering, a practical estimate is about 1.1–1.4 tons per cubic yard; many homeowners use 1.25 tons/yd3 for estimates and add 10–20% extra for settlement and compaction. How does Willard's local soil and drainage affect how much fill dirt I should order?

Willard sits in the coastal plain where soils can be sandy or clayey and the water table may be relatively high after heavy rains, so expect some extra settlement and slower drainage in low spots. For areas with poor drainage, you may need additional compacted fill and a capped layer of crushed stone for a stable base rather than relying on fill dirt alone. If your property borders wetlands or a floodplain, check local permitting requirements before raising grades.

Can I use fill dirt for a driveway or parking area in Willard?

Fill dirt alone is not recommended as a finished surface for driveways because it can rut and hold water. It can be used as a compacted subgrade to raise low areas, but you should cap it with a structural layer such as road base or crushed stone and compaction between lifts for long-term performance. For driveways exposed to traffic and rain in Willard, a crushed stone or road base surface is the better choice.

How long does fill dirt settle, and how do I manage settlement on my property?

Most settlement happens during the first several months to a year after placement, especially if the material is placed loosely or over organic soils. To reduce future settling, place fill in 6–8 inch lifts and compact each layer; hiring a compaction contractor or renting a plate compactor helps. Plan to leave extra material or budget for a minor top-up and regrading after the first wet season.

What is the difference between fill dirt, topsoil, and road base for Willard projects?

Fill dirt is subsoil with little organic matter used to raise or grade land; it’s not good for planting. Topsoil is nutrient-rich and used for lawns and gardens. Road base or crushed stone is angular, compactable material designed to carry traffic loads and provide drainage; use it for driveways, pads, and areas where stability and drainage matter.

How do delivery logistics work in a small town like Willard? What should I prepare?

Deliveries usually come by tri-axle dump truck and require clear access to the drop spot; narrow driveways, low-hanging wires, and soft shoulders can limit placement. Mark the exact drop location, remove cars and obstacles, and consider laying plywood to protect lawns. What maintenance do I need after placing fill dirt on my yard or build site?

After placement and compaction, keep an eye on low spots and ruts, especially after heavy rains, and regrade or add material as needed during the first year. If you plan to landscape, add a layer of topsoil before planting or sodding. For areas that will see traffic, cap the fill with road base or crushed stone and compact to maintain stability.
